Choosing the right length for your shower curtain can significantly improve your bathroom experience. A long shower curtain typically measures around 72 to 84 inches in height. This extra length helps keep water from splashing onto your bathroom floor. A properly fitted long curtain creates a more enclosed space, allowing for better steam retention and warmth during your shower.
When selecting a long shower curtain, consider the height of your shower rod. Measure from the floor to the rod, ensuring that the curtain will hang just above the base. A common mistake is choosing a curtain that is too short, leading to puddles on the floor. Think about stylish patterns and colors too. A well-chosen curtain will become a focal point in your bathroom.
**Tips**:
1. Select a fabric that resists mold and mildew for longevity.
2. Consider a weighted hem to prevent the curtain from blowing inwards during a shower.
3. Always wash or replace your curtain regularly to maintain hygiene.

Long shower curtains are essential for modern bathrooms. They offer additional coverage for taller or larger shower spaces. This ensures that water does not splash onto the floor. Various materials contribute to their effectiveness and style.
Many people choose fabric shower curtains. They come in various textures and patterns. These can add an artistic touch to your bathroom. However, fabric curtains may require more maintenance and washing. Vinyl, on the other hand, is durable and easy to clean. It’s great for moisture-heavy environments but may not offer the same aesthetic appeal.
When selecting a long shower curtain, consider the style that complements your bathroom decor. A bright, bold print can make a statement, while neutral tones can create a serene atmosphere. Be sure to measure your shower space to ensure a proper fit.
Tips: Always check the manufacturer's cleaning instructions. This helps maintain the curtain's appearance. Also, think about adding a liner for extra protection against moisture. Choosing the right hook or ring is equally important for both function and style.
Long shower curtains are essential for larger spaces. They help keep water contained, preventing slippery floors and maintaining a clean bathroom environment. However, maintenance is crucial to ensure their longevity and appearance.
Cleaning long shower curtains should be part of your routine. Many can go in the washing machine, but always check care labels. Regular washing helps prevent mold and mildew. You might notice stains over time, especially if you live in a humid area. It's a good idea to rinse your curtain after each use. This simple step reduces build-up and extends the fabric’s life.
Storing your curtain properly is also essential. A damp curtain should not be left in the shower. This habit can lead to unpleasant odors and quick deterioration. If you notice fading or tearing, consider replacing it. Waiting too long can lead to more extensive damage. Taking these actions can enhance your shower experience greatly.
